An intubation dummy is a synthetic model that closely mimics the anatomy of the human airway. It is specifically designed to provide a realistic simulation of intubation procedures, allowing medical trainees to practice various intubation techniques in a controlled environment. By using an intubation dummy, medical professionals can improve their intubation skills, gain confidence, and ultimately enhance patient outcomes.
There are several key benefits of using an intubation dummy in medical training. One of the most significant advantages is the ability to practice intubation techniques repeatedly without the risk of causing harm to a live patient. In a high-stress, time-sensitive situation such as an emergency intubation, having adequate training and experience can make a significant difference in the successful outcome of the procedure. An intubation dummy provides a safe and controlled environment for medical professionals to practice and refine their intubation skills, allowing them to build muscle memory and improve their technique over time.
Another important benefit of using an intubation dummy is the ability to simulate a variety of clinical scenarios. Different intubation techniques may be required depending on the patient’s condition, such as in cases of difficult airways or cervical spine injuries. An intubation dummy can be configured to replicate these challenging scenarios, providing medical trainees with valuable hands-on experience in managing complex intubation cases. By exposing trainees to a wide range of clinical scenarios, an intubation dummy helps to prepare them for real-life situations where quick thinking and adaptability are essential.
Furthermore, an intubation dummy allows for objective assessment of performance and skill development. Many intubation dummies are equipped with advanced features such as anatomically accurate airways, realistic vocal cords, and sensors that provide real-time feedback on intubation technique. This feedback can help medical trainees identify areas for improvement, track their progress, and ultimately enhance their proficiency in performing intubation procedures. By incorporating objective assessment into intubation training, medical educators can ensure that trainees meet the highest standards of clinical competence and patient safety.
